Custom child channels get unsubscribed while changing base channel for system from Red Hat provided channel to clone/custom channel.

Solution Verified - Updated -

Issue

  • Trying to switch a systems base Red Hat channel to cloned channel, custom child channels get unsubscribed.
  • Custom child channels get unsubscribed while changing base channel for system from Red Hat provided channel to clone/custom channel.
  • 1. Go to "Systems" tab, Select system profile.
    2. Go to "System Set Manager" (SSM)
    3.  "Channels" -> "Base Channels" -> Select "custom base channel" from "Desired base channel" -> "Confirm  Subscriptions"

    Unmatched Child Channels 
     
    Some of the systems in your set are
    currently subscribed to the channels in the 'Old Channel' column below,
    but suitable matches for the following child channels could not be
    found under the proposed new base channels. As a result, the systems in
    the 'Systems Affected' column will be unsubscribed from the 'Old
    Channels' listed below. Please note that these systems may have
    packages installed that will no longer receive updates, including
    security updates, after their base channel has been switched. *
    

Environment

  • Red Hat Network (RHN) Satellite v 5.2
  •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L) 5
